First Aired 1/13/2004

The ceremonial burning of a stolen car marks the end of summer on the Chatsworth Estate in Manchester. Meet the local family — the Gallaghers. There's dad Frank and his six kids, Lip, Ian, Carl, Debbie, Liam and Fiona. Into their world steps Steve. Cool, well mannered, well dressed and romantic, he makes a beeline for big sister Fiona. Steve's soon getting his feet under the table but why he wants them there, no one quite knows.

First Aired 1/3/2006

Puberty catches up with the Gallaghers: Carl discovers sex and ASBOs, Debbie struggles with her grown-up responsibilities and little Liam denounces religion at his RC Primary School. Lip becomes a dad while Ian’s heart gets badly broken. And Sheila’s valium-fuelled white wedding dream turns into the wedding of the century, so even Frank can’t ignore it! Tourettes’ sufferer Marty is loved up with Sue although he has yet to find out about her biggest secret. Next door, Veronica and Kev hit dangerous ground when his real wife turns up. And mum, Carol, finds that shoplifting is not so easy. New councillor Kash proves he’s bent in every way and Karen gets more than she bargained for at The Jockey.

First Aired 1/9/2007

In the fourth series the residents of Manchester's most outrageous estate have two new cops to contend with. But the Gallaghers don't need to worry now they've teamed up with the Maguires. Especially when, after a stint in prison, prodigal son Jamie Maguire arrives to set sparks flying with Karen. Then there are his brothers, the not-so-bright Shane and Micky, a wannabe hard-man struggling with his own secrets. Frank and the kids are sent into a spin when mum Monica turns up, claiming to be back for good. Lip is taking his parental responsibilities seriously until thoughts of university offer him the escape he's always wanted. Carol is back but still having trouble keeping her legs and mouth shut, while Kash is happy screwing the council. And what is the connection between Kev, Veronica, Marty, Sue and a Romanian baby?
